Summary

Includes information on chip carving history, wood selection, tools, sharpening and cutting techniques. Also includes sections on borders, grids, rosettes, foliage, lettering and finishing. Features seven step-by-step demonstrations including a trivet, a napkin holder, a coaster set, a box and more.

About The Author

Dennis Moor

Dennis “Pop” Moor, along with his son Todd, has taken the carving world by storm, winning numerous international awards. The carving, teaching, and judging reputation of this father-son team is exceptional, especially because of the entertaining approach they take to their art. Dennis and Todd’s weekly television series has introduced viewers to all areas of woodcarving and wood art and has helped to establish the duo as highly sought-after personalities at woodcarving shows and competitions. It is no wonder these two are often called “The Canadian Masters.” Together, they founded Chipping Away Incorporated, dedicated to the advancement of woodcarving and wood art.
